Is it possible to Buy Adderall Over the Counter in the USA?

Adderall is a prescription medication used to treat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) and narcolepsy. Due to its potential for abuse and dependence, Adderall can't be purchased over the counter in the United States. To obtain Adderall, individuals must seek a prescription from a healthcare professional. A doctor will evaluate your symptoms for you and issue a prescription if necessary.

Purchasing Adderall without a valid prescription is illegal and can have serious consequences. It's essential to obtain medication through legitimate means to ensure your safety and well-being.
